We're offering a training session June 2 on how to tell a story using an audio slideshow
Come join us Saturday, June 2 from 1 to 4:30 p.m. for a training session on Soundslides, a popular computer program used by journalists to create online audio slideshows. We'll hold the training in a computer lab (Room 140) at the North City campus of the San Diego Community College District, 8401 Aero Dr. Our trainers at the session will be Yvette de la Garza and Jeff Dillon, both of the SignOnSanDiego staff. We'll have photos and sound clips loaded on the machines so you can follow along and create your own slideshow, with the help of our instructor from SignOn San Diego. We're also hoping to offer instruction on Audacity, a sound-editing program.
